5-star luxury landmark hotel in Washington, D.C.
Location
Waldorf Astoria Washington D.C. resides on Pennsylvania Avenue, strategically located between The White House and the U.S. Capitol. The hotel's proximity to significant sites includes the National Mall museums, Washington Monument, and Lincoln Memorial. This location positions the hotel as a hub for notable events and meetings.
Rooms and Suites
The hotel offers 263 guest rooms and suites, known for being among the largest in Washington D.C. Many rooms provide impressive views of Pennsylvania Avenue and feature premium furnishings. The luxurious accommodations include a selection of suites like the Presidential One Bedroom Suite, showcasing historical significance.
Dining
Dining options include Michelin-starred establishments such as Sushi Nakazawa and The Bazaar by José Andrés, featuring innovative culinary experiences. Peacock Alley offers a casual yet sophisticated atmosphere with classic dishes and crafted cocktails. In-room dining is available around the clock for convenience.
Wellness
Waldorf Astoria Spa presents a refined sanctuary with six treatment rooms, including a Himalayan Salt Therapy Room for relaxation. Guests can enjoy the Couple's Journeys experience, which includes signature massages and private amenities. The spa prioritizes personalized wellness in an exclusive setting.
Events
With 38,942 square feet of event space, the hotel is equipped to accommodate gatherings ranging from intimate meetings to grand receptions. The Grand Ballroom, column-free, can host up to 1,300 guests, complete with a separate entrance. Unique venues, such as the historic Lincoln Library, enhance the significance of events held at the hotel.

Smithsonian National Museum of Natural History
6 minutes' walk
Extensive exhibits showcase fossils, gems, and a live butterfly pavilion. Free admission makes it a must-visit destination.
Ford's Theatre
5 minutes' walk
Historic site of Lincoln's assassination, featuring engaging exhibits and live performances. Tickets recommended for shows.
Washington Monument
14 minutes' walk
Iconic landmark offering panoramic views of D.C. from the top. Reservations required for elevator access.
National Gallery of Art
13 minutes' walk
Home to masterpieces from the Middle Ages to the present. Free guided tours enhance the visitor experience.
